簡體   English   中英

使用SSL測試環境服務器

[英]Testing environment server with SSL

我有測試服務器,該服務器包含Subversion存儲庫,Redmine for PM,當然-這是我的測試環境。

問題是我想用SSL加密我的所有連接。 手動創建SSL時,出現了很多問題:Redmine不信任該證書,我的生產服務器無法更新其工作副本,而不會提示接受證書(我無法回答,因為我無權訪問控制台上的控制台)托管服務器),每當我結帳測試應用程序(webApp)時,我都需要證明不受信任的證書(Google Chrome),今天我的證書過期了粉碎的redmine,而我無法使用新的證書回到正軌...問題還在繼續。

因此, 我的問題是 :是否可以擁有我自己的SSL證書,而至少沒有上述大多數問題? 買一個不是真正的解決方案,因為如果您明白我的意思,那是“不必要的支出”。

對於SVN,可以使用以下命令:

svn up --trust-server-cert --non-interactive

我不確定將它導入RedMine的熱門,但是我總是使用file://-URL,因為我的redmine和SVN位於同一服務器上(這也更快,不需要任何授權)。

此開關僅在SVN 1.6中可用。 您還可以(自)簽名證書,並將簽名的證書添加到Subversion的服務器配置文件中:

ssl-authority-files = /path/to/cert-file

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M